Solution Overview

Problem

Users face difficulties in controlling multiple electronic devices simultaneously or sequentially, especially when carrying or wearing them, as existing systems lack efficient methods for coordinating commands across these devices.

Innovation Solution

An electronic device with a communication unit, memory, and controller is used to transmit control commands to other devices, allowing for group control by determining whether a command is a group control command and transmitting it to registered devices, enabling simultaneous or sequential operation.

Engineering Contradictions & Design Principles

VSEngineering Contradiction Analysis

1Ease of operation

If a user manually controls each electronic device separately, then each device can be controlled individually, but the user experiences difficulty and complexity in managing multiple devices

Engineering Contradiction:
Improveease of controlling multiple devicesVSAvoidcomplexity of managing multiple devices
Core Design Contradiction:
Ease of operationVSDevice complexity

Solution Approach 1:

The patent combines multiple electronic devices into a unified group that can be controlled through a single master device. The controller integrates control functions for multiple devices (smartwatch, smartglasses, tablet, smartphone) into one system, allowing the user to issue a single command from the master device to control all grouped devices simultaneously, thereby simplifying operation and reducing management complexity.

Inventive Principle:
Principle #5Merging (Combining)

Solution Approach 2:

The master device is designed with universal control capability to manage various types of electronic devices with different functions. The controller can identify and execute appropriate control commands for different device types (voice call, video call, messaging, etc.) through a single interface, making the control system adaptable to multiple device functionalities without requiring separate control mechanisms for each device.

Inventive Principle:
Principle #6Universality (Multi-functionality)

2Productivity

If the system transmits control commands to all grouped devices, then simultaneous control is achieved, but communication overhead and processing time increase

Engineering Contradiction:
Improvespeed of controlling multiple devicesVSAvoidtime for command transmission and processing
Core Design Contradiction:
ProductivityVSLoss of time

Solution Approach 1:

The system performs preliminary actions by pre-establishing group relationships and storing device information before actual control operations. The controller maintains a registry of grouped devices and their capabilities in advance, so when a control command is issued, the system can immediately transmit to all devices without delay for device discovery or capability negotiation, thereby reducing real-time processing time while maintaining high productivity.

Inventive Principle:
Principle #10Preliminary action

Data Source

PatentUS10863483B2Method and apparatus for controlling a electronic device in a communication system
Publication Date: 2020.12.08 SAMSUNG ELECTRONICS CO LTD

AI summary

A method and apparatus is provided that controls other electronic devices through one electronic device in a communication system. The electronic device for executing control commands includes a communication unit configured to communicate with at least one of other electronic devices, a memory configured to store identification information about other electronic devices to execute a group control command, and a controller configured to execute, when receiving the control command, the received control command, determine whether the received control command is a group control command that other electronic devices need to execute in the same way as the electronic device, read, when the received control command is a group control command, identification information about at least one of other electronic devices as group control objects from the memory, and transmit the identification information to other electronic devices.
